黑臭水形成的水质和环境条件研究
Study on the water quality and environmental conditions of the formation of black-odorous water
【摘要】 水体黑臭是城乡普遍的水环境问题,严重影响水体景观和水质安全.揭示高污染水体产生黑臭的具体水质和环境条件阈值,对于水体黑臭预警、预防和治理工作有重要意义.根据黑臭水普遍特征,人工自制典型黑臭水,分析了总有机碳、总氮、Fe2+浓度、温度、溶氧、水深等对黑臭水形成的影响,从水质参数与环境条件两方面分析黑臭水形成的阈值条件.研究结果表明,在本试验条件下,当总有机碳≥150mg/L,总氮≥50mg/L,Fe2+浓度≥0.2mg/L,温度≥25℃,水深≥0.9m及厌氧条件时,高污染水体会发生黑臭.
【Abstract】 The black and odorous water body is a common environmental problem in urban and rural areas over china,which is detrimental to aesthetics of water body and water safety.Elucidating the thresholds of water quality and environmental conditions that cause polluted water becoming black and odorous is important for the warning,prevention and control of black-odor water bodies.In this paper,the typical black-odor water was prepared according to the characteristics of black-odor water.The effects of water quality and environmental conditions,e.g.total organic carbon,total nitrogen,Fe2+,dissolved oxygen,temperature and water depth,on the formation of black-odorous water were investigated.The results showed that in this experiment the conditions for the formation of black-odorous water are total organic carbon≥150mg/L,total nitrogen≥50mg/L,Fe2+≥0.2mg/L,temperature≥25℃,water depth≥0.9 mand anaerobic condition.
